

Textile with Stripes and Confronted Birds
Brown textile with frayed edges and several horizontal stripes. The top and bottom stripes are light red with geometric patterns. The middle stripe has a repeating pattern of two confronted birds with their heads facing each other and bodies facing away, surrounded by geometric shapes. The background is beige.
